I'm collecting blocked process reports using Extended Events, and for some reason in some reports the blocking-process node is empty. This is the full xml:

Does anybody have an explanation for these reports? What is blocking the query?
Is there any way to find out what was happening if I'm looking at the reports after the locks have long gone?
One thing that might be useful to add is that these queries are run via sp_cursorprepareand sp_cursorexecute
So far I haven't been able to reproduce it, it seems to happen randomly but very often.
It happens on several instances (of different builds) and several tables/queries, all related to Dynamics AX.
There are no index or other database maintenance jobs occurring in the background at the time.
